Butternut Squash & Turkey Meatloaf

Winter squash season is right around the corner and I am getting started with this delicious loaf. I love the squash addition in this meal makes it a delicious fall dinner.

Recipe

Ingredients:
• 1 package ground turkey (about ~1lb)
• ½ small butternut squash, peeled, deseeded and cut into ½-inch chunks, about 1 heaping cup 
• 1 egg
• ½ cup almond flour
• 1 teaspoon salt & black pepper
• ½ cup shredded mozzarella, I used non-dairy 
• 2 garlic cloves, minced
• ½ white onion, chopped
• ¼ cup fresh parsley, chopped
• ½ tablespoon plant sterol 
For the glaze
• 1 tablespoon ketchup 
• 1 teaspoon low-sodium soy sauce
Directions:
1.) Preheat oven to 375F and line a bread pan with foil and spray with cooking spray. Set aside.
2.) Heat a skillet over medium heat and melt the plant sterol. Add in the butternut squash and cook for 7 minutes, till tender. Next add in the garlic and onion and cook for another 5 minutes. 
3.) In a large bowl combine the ground turkey, parsley, spices, mozzarella, egg and almond four. Mix well. Next fold in the butternut squash veggie mix. 
4.) Transfer to prepared bread loaf pan. Next make the glaze by mixing together the ketchup and soy sauce. Brush glaze over meatloaf. 
5.) Bake for 45-50 minutes, till done. Enjoy!
